    What is: Z-Bend (Mobility Exercise)

    What is the Z-Bend Mobility Exercise?

    The Z-Bend mobility exercise is a dynamic movement designed to enhance flexibility and mobility in the hips, lower back, and legs. This exercise is particularly beneficial for athletes and fitness enthusiasts who require a full range of motion for their activities. By incorporating the Z-Bend into your routine, you can improve your overall performance and reduce the risk of injuries associated with tight muscles and joints.

    How to Perform the Z-Bend Mobility Exercise

    To perform the Z-Bend mobility exercise, start by standing with your feet shoulder-width apart. Bend your knees slightly and hinge at your hips, lowering your torso towards the ground while keeping your back straight. As you lower your body, shift your weight to one side, allowing your hips to move laterally. Hold the position for a few seconds before returning to the starting position and repeating on the opposite side. Aim for 10-15 repetitions on each side to maximize the benefits.

    Common Mistakes to Avoid

    When performing the Z-Bend mobility exercise, it is essential to avoid common mistakes that can hinder its effectiveness. One common error is rounding the back while bending forward, which can lead to strain and injury. Instead, focus on maintaining a neutral spine throughout the movement. Additionally, avoid forcing the stretch; instead, listen to your body and progress at your own pace to prevent overexertion.

    Incorporating the Z-Bend into Your Routine

    The Z-Bend mobility exercise can be easily incorporated into your warm-up or cool-down routine. Consider performing it before engaging in high-intensity workouts or sports to prepare your muscles and joints for movement. Alternatively, you can include it in your post-workout stretching routine to aid in recovery and maintain flexibility. Consistency is key, so aim to practice the Z-Bend several times a week for optimal results.

    Variations of the Z-Bend Mobility Exercise

    There are several variations of the Z-Bend mobility exercise that can target different muscle groups and enhance your overall mobility. For example, you can perform the exercise with a resistance band to add an extra challenge or incorporate a rotational movement to engage your core. Experimenting with different variations can keep your routine fresh and help you discover new ways to improve your mobility.

    Who Can Benefit from the Z-Bend Mobility Exercise?

    The Z-Bend mobility exercise is suitable for individuals of all fitness levels, from beginners to advanced athletes. It is particularly beneficial for those who spend long hours sitting, as it helps counteract the negative effects of prolonged inactivity. Additionally, anyone looking to enhance their flexibility, improve athletic performance, or recover from injuries can greatly benefit from incorporating the Z-Bend into their fitness regimen.

    Safety Considerations

    While the Z-Bend mobility exercise is generally safe for most individuals, it is essential to listen to your body and avoid pushing beyond your limits. If you experience pain or discomfort during the exercise, stop immediately and consult a healthcare professional if necessary. It is also advisable to warm up before performing the Z-Bend to prepare your muscles and joints for the movement.
